Gulf States Industrial Regional Sales Manager

General Description/Purpose:

The primary responsibilities of this position are to grow the market share and develop a loyal customer base through direct selling and utilization of marketing tools to achieve sales forecast targets. The Regional Sales Manager will be responsible for growing and maintaining sales within an assigned region including recruiting, training, and development of channel partners within a specified region. The Gulf States territory covers the states of Georgia, Mississippi, Alabama, and Florida. Preference will be given to candidates who reside in one of the states within the territory.

Job Duties (Including but not limited to):

  • Develop, market, and sell all GEMÜ product lines to all applicable accounts within in the applicable region. Those products include the IND product line and support of the PFB (Pharmaceutical, Food, Biotechnology), instrumentation, and SEM (Semiconductor & Microelectronic) product lines.
  • Utilize specialized distribution in conjunction with developing OEM accounts that offer profitable growth while minimizing conflict distribution.
  • Oversee and audit distributor's work at end user level. Responsible for identifying, contacting, and developing new accounts. Once account is properly developed, responsible for smooth transition of account to distribution or direct status.
  • Set up seminars at A&E firms by working with appropriate Product Managers to influence valve specifications and ensure GEMÜ is specified.
